Looking for a Mod to store contacts information.

Features:
  • Replace Members menu button
  • Add Contacts, Name, Company Name, Phone Numbers, Addresses, Email Addresses, Etc
  • Edit Contacts - Would be nice if reason for editing a contact could be required
  • Notes - Would like to be able to add notes to contacts
  • Categories - Customer, Vendor, Etc. Also would like the ability to sort/filter by category
  • Group Contacts - Ability to add multiple contacts to a group, for example several contacts from one company or family
  • Log - Log who added, edited, or deleted a contact
  • Merge contact info with member profile where possible, manually or auto match email address is fine. If doable.

Permissions
  • View/Access Contacts List
  • Add New Contact - With or without approval
  • Approve Contacts
  • Edit Contacts - If edits can require approval that would be great, just in the event the edit turns out to be a mistake
  • Remove/Delete Contacts - Admin/Group 1 approval required

Purpose
The reason for this mod, is about as simple as the name suggests. I currently have a small group of people working together and we all seem to have different contact information and we would like to store them for easy access and keep it maintained. We use SMF for most of discussions as a means to keep things documented and figured why not just store the contacts as well, instead of constantly searching or asking each other if we have such a contact etc. We tried using topics to do this but its getting annoying (at least to me) and rather have them in their own section.
